Why is it important for Christians to live righteously?

Answered in 2 sources

Living righteously is important for Christians as it reflects our identity in Christ and demonstrates our commitment to His will.

Righteous living is fundamental for Christians because it not only aligns with our identity as those redeemed by Christ but also serves as a witness to the world of His transforming power. Romans 6:22 teaches that having been set free from sin, believers are called to become servants of righteousness, leading lives that adorn the doctrine of Christ. Righteousness is more than a set of rules; it embodies a heart and lifestyle committed to God's glory. When Christians live righteously, they manifest the character of Christ, exhibit love and good works, and fulfill the purpose for which they were created. Moreover, righteous living nurtures spiritual growth and fosters a deeper relationship with God.
Scripture References: Romans 6:22, Titus 2:14, 1 Thessalonians 4:1, 1 Kings 11:12
